- Why
laser marking? |
|
| |
 |
| |
 |
| |
| PERMANENT |
| Laser marking is permanent and
indelible marking process, which stands against wiping, scuffing,
impacts, wear and tear, can only be removed by grinding or surface
removal. Thus laser - marking sustains authenticity of your
brand against sort of tempering |
| |
| NON-CONTACT TYPE |
| Laser marking is non-contact
type process. It does not produce any deformation in product
unlike in punching, stamping, pneumatic pin, vibratory pencil
etc. This gives accurate and aesthetic marking independent of
hardness of material. |
| |
| FLEXIBILITY |
| Laser marking is highly flexible
process compared to any other marking process. It can mark any
images and fonts without changing any punch, die, stencil etc.
unlike other conventional process. |
| |
| AESTHETIC/ACCURACY |
| Since laser can produce very
fine beam with accuracy in micron, many accurate and micro details
with precision can be marked with laser marking. Laser can produce
aesthetic images which otherwise difficult to create with other
marking process. |
| |
| NO PRE/POST PROCESSING |
| Since Laser marking is non-contact
type, no pre or post processing is required, which in turn significantly
increase marking productivity. |
| |
| LOW OPERATING COST |
| Laser marking helps significantly
in cutting operating cost by reducing labor cost, tool cost,
consumable cost, set up time, rejection improved cycle time. |
| |
| AUTOMATION |
| One of the prime advantage of
laser marking is that it can be automized and can be integrated
with any online process. With support of software, even variable
serial nos., batch nos., date of bar code can be marked. |
